flyrain commented on code in PR #10831:
URL: https://github.com/apache/iceberg/pull/10831#discussion_r1699255366


##########
format/spec.md:
##########
@@ -164,6 +164,8 @@ A **`list`** is a collection of values with some element 
type. The element field
 
 A **`map`** is a collection of key-value pairs with a key type and a value 
type. Both the key field and value field each have an integer id that is unique 
in the table schema. Map keys are required and map values can be either 
optional or required. Both map keys and map values may be any type, including 
nested types.
 
+A **`variant`** is a type to represent semi-structured data. A variant value 
can store a value of any other type, including any primitive, struct, list or 
map values. The variant value is encoded in its own binary 
[encoding](variant-spec.md). Variant type is ddded in [v3](#version-3).

Review Comment:
   ddded -> added. Or we can say Variant type is a part of the v3 spec.



-- 
This is an automated message from the Apache Git Service.
To respond to the message, please log on to GitHub and use the
URL above to go to the specific comment.

To unsubscribe, e-mail: issues-unsubscr...@iceberg.apache.org

For queries about this service, please contact Infrastructure at:
us...@infra.apache.org


---------------------------------------------------------------------
To unsubscribe, e-mail: issues-unsubscr...@iceberg.apache.org
For additional commands, e-mail: issues-h...@iceberg.apache.org

Reply via email to